My 1983 Firebird is leaking transmission where a line connects to the transmission. It is a manual. I was wondering if anyone knows what the line or cable or whatever it is is called? It has fittings like a water hose. Does anyone have any idea what this is?

Oh, that sounds like you speedometer cable. I believe those have a seal. Probably just needs a new one.
